        "content": "<p>Govt tightens grip ahead of GAM anniversary<\/p>\n<p>Nani Afrida and Tiarma Siboro<br>\nThe Jakarta Post\/Banda Aceh\/Jakarta<\/p>\n<p>Anticipating possible skirmishes during the 28th anniversary of <br>\nthe Aceh Free Movement (GAM) on Dec. 4, the civil emergency <br>\nadministration on Friday banned the populace from engaging in any <br>\nactivities related to the occasion.<\/p>\n<p>Acting administrator of the civil emergency, Insp. Gen. <br>\nBahrumsyah Kasman, ordered all private institutions, government <br>\nagencies, non-governmental organizations as well as the media to <br>\nignore the commemoration.<\/p>\n<p>\"All institutions are barred from discussing, producing, <br>\ndisseminating or broadcasting information related to the <br>\nanniversary of the separatist movement,\" Bahrumsyah said, adding <br>\nthat the public should also notify the security authorities over <br>\npossible breaches of the order.<\/p>\n<p>He also called on security personnel deployed in the strife-<br>\ntorn province to step up their vigilance.<\/p>\n<p>\"Security personnel are urged to take more initiatives in <br>\nresponding to developments and take all necessary actions in <br>\naccordance with existing regulations,\" he said.<\/p>\n<p>The civil emergency administration in Aceh has beefed up <br>\nsecurity measures in areas considered as GAM strongholds, such as <br>\nTanah Jambo Aye, Matangkuli, Sawang Langkahan and Nisam <br>\nsubdistricts.<\/p>\n<p>It also plans to deploy reconnaissance aircraft to monitor the <br>\nactivities of the separatist movement and launch airstrikes if <br>\nnecessary.<\/p>\n<p>Government-sponsored anti-separatist groups are also expected <br>\nto boost the drive by providing free medical services for <br>\nresidents in Nisam, Paya Bakong, Matangkuli and Lhokseumawe.<\/p>\n<p>The civil emergency administration issued the order based on <br>\nGovernment Regulation No. 2\/2004 on the extension of civil <br>\nemergency in the province.<\/p>\n<p>\"Violators of this order will be charged under the law on the <br>\nstate of emergency and\/or relevant regulations,\" Bachrumsyah <br>\nsaid.<\/p>\n<p>Although not cowed by the order, GAM earlier appealed to <br>\nAcehnese to stay at their homes and halt all activities during <br>\nthe commemoration, citing people's safety as the main reason.<\/p>\n<p>\"The anniversary is a historical moment for all Acehnese and <br>\nwe (GAM) believe that all of us pay the same reverence to the <br>\nevent.<\/p>\n<p>\"And since the safety of all Acehnese is our concern, we ask <br>\nyou all to stay at home and stop your activities between 6 a.m. <br>\nand 12 midday, during which we (GAM) will hold the <br>\ncommemoration,\" Muzakkir said from GAM central command <br>\nheadquarters in the Tiro area.<\/p>\n<p>Muzakkir's statement was aimed at cautioning Acehnese with the <br>\nprospect of government's troops intensifying their operations to <br>\nprevent GAM-related activities throughout the territory where <br>\nJakarta has imposed state of emergency for the past one-and-half <br>\nyear to crush the secessionist movement.<\/p>\n<p>GAM has been fighting for independence since 1976. The <br>\nconflict has resulted in the deaths of over 10,000 people.<\/p>\n<p>The government launched a major operation to crush the rebels <br>\nin May last year, costing the state Rp 2.6 trillion (US$288.9 <br>\nmillion).<\/p>\n<p>The Indonesian Military claimed to have killed 3,200 rebels <br>\nand captured 4,500 others during the operation.<\/p>",
